The principle of an esophageal ultrasound probe is to obtain ultrasound images using a small ultrasound probe installed inside the tip of the probe. It is expensive, has a precise and complex structure, and is made of special materials. Its requirements for post-use processing are very high, posing a severe challenge to the reprocessing work of such instruments in the sterilization supply center:

Figure 1 Esophageal Ultrasound Probe and Main Structure

 

Power Connector:The core of the pin area is the circuit board,Cannot Enter water,easy to corrode and cause short circuits. How to waterproof during cleaning?

Cable:Contains a built-in metal wire with an outer soft rubber protective layer; excessive pulling during handling can cause cable breakage, affecting image quality;The soft rubber protective layer is easily damaged, duringhandling, what should be paid attention to?

Operating Handle and Knob:The knob is connected to the built-in metal wire and has gaps. If disinfectant or other liquids Enter the control device,it will corrode the gears,Cannot be fully immersed for cleaning and disinfection?

Insertion Part and TipDuring treatment, it contacts the patient's mouth, esophagus, and gastric cavity. Contaminants include saliva, esophageal secretions, and gastric juice. The gastric juice has a pH of 2-3, which is strongly acidic and easilycorrodes the instrument,how to achieve effective pre-processing?

Manufacturer's Instructions"Avoid using coupling agents containing ethanol, propanol, mineral oil, grease, or any type of detergent or softener, as they may damage the probe." The probe is made of soft rubber materialand is not resistant to high temperatures. Whattype of disinfection method and disinfectant is more appropriate?
